Hi, we are a couple (just turned 30) and found that a lot of the outlying places like secret harbour looked just to quiet, theres not much out there.
I would say go for somewhere closer to the city theres some nice places just 15mins drive that are nice and quiet, have nice houses and yet if you want a night out theres plenty of cinemas, restuarnts, pubs and clubs.
A lot of it depends on the indervidual street. We are living in Dianella now which is nice as its got a massive shopping complex but is 15-20mins from city
Victoria park is also ok, never had any trouble there and its quiet cheap
